Hotaler is a UAE-based hotel channel management and distribution platform for independent hotels, growing properties, and hotel groups. It focuses on managing Booking.com, Expedia, Airbnb, Agoda, Google Hotels, GDS, PMS, and a hotel’s own direct booking engine in one platform, helping synchronize rates, inventory, restrictions, and reservations while reducing manual updates and the risk of overbooking.
For channel management, Hotaler claims support for 50+ OTAs, GDS, PMS, and metasearch platforms, with real-time two-way synchronization. Its pages mention syncing “within 3 seconds / 5 seconds.” The direct booking engine supports white-label branding, hotel-owned domains, 6 languages, RTL Arabic, 32 currencies, and payments via Stripe, Telr, and PayTabs. Revenue management includes dynamic pricing based on occupancy, day of week, and booking window, with RevPAR/ADR tracking. PMS integrations include Mews, Cloudbeds, Apaleo, Oracle Opera Cloud, Hotelogix, Ezee Absolute, and more, with references to REST API, OAuth 2.0, webhooks, and OHIP.
Pricing is relatively clear: Starter is $29/month, or $24/month billed annually; Professional is $79/month, or $66/month billed annually; Enterprise is $199/month, or $166/month billed annually. The three tiers are segmented by number of properties, channels, and user seats, and a 14-day free trial is available with no credit card required. One thing to note: one pricing card states that Starter includes 3 channels and Professional includes 10 channels, while the feature comparison lists OTA Connections as Up to 10, Up to 30, and Unlimited respectively, so the wording is inconsistent.
The main strengths are broad channel coverage, especially platforms relevant to Middle East, India, Southeast Asia, and China source markets, such as Almosafer, MakeMyTrip, Traveloka, and Trip.com. Its 0% commission direct booking, free Google Hotels links, and two-way PMS synchronization also provide practical value for hotel operations. The drawbacks are that the website does not disclose key enterprise-level information such as data security, compliance certifications, backups, or permission roles. The captured content also contains leftover template code, which slightly affects the product’s professional presentation.
Hotaler is best suited to hotels or hotel groups that need to manage multiple OTAs in one place, want to grow direct bookings, and require PMS integrations, especially those targeting the UAE, GCC, India, and international source markets. Access from mainland China, subscription payment methods, and localization support are not disclosed, so they should be considered unknown. For deployment in the China market, it would be important to verify network connectivity, Trip.com/payment workflows, customer support time zones, and alternatives such as SiteMinder, Cloudbeds, Hotelogix, and eZee Absolute.
